Move a Camera to the Preset Position

Moves a camera to the preset position registered in advance. Registering preset positions is required to perform the
preset function.
Refer to the operating instructions of the connected camera for the descriptions of how to register the preset posi-
tion. It is impossible to register the preset positions of cameras using this unit.
Screenshot 1
Display the [CAM] tab.

Step 1
Click the [i] button in the [Preset] box to select a pre-
set number (HOME, 1 - 256) to be moved.
Step 2
Click the [Go] button.
→ The camera moves to the registered preset position
respective to the selected preset number.
STEP1
Click the [i] button in the [Auto mode] box to select a
mode (Auto Pan, etc.) to be started.
Step 2
The auto mode function can be performed by clicking
the [Start] button in the [Auto mode] box.
Click the [Stop] button to stop the auto mode function.
Note:
Refer to the operating instructions of the connected
camera for further information about the auto mode
function of the camera.
